    New ideas about Twitter usage


    So I was reading some of my RSS feeds and learning from experts like Tech Crunch when I found an article from their website. This article first caught my attention by the headline, “A Missed Opportunity – Britney On Twitter” but as I read the article I realized that it was about so much more.

    The main idea that I pulled from this article was the concept of Twitter having different pay models for users such as free, pay or a mix of the two for followers to access a Twitter feed. This article even suggested that Twitter could earn revenue from this model.
